Immerse Yourself in the Ancient Art of Traditional Chinese Healing
For millennia, Traditional Chinese Practices has Nourished the well-being of generations. This Ancient system views health as a harmonious balance of Energy flowing through the Channels. Practitioners utilize Traditions such as acupuncture, herbal Prescriptions, and tai chi to restore equilibrium and promote Renewal.
- {Acupuncture|, a key practice, involves inserting fine needles into specific points on the body to stimulate energy flow and alleviate pain.
- Herbal Medicine draws upon a vast knowledge of plants and their medicinal properties to create Mixtures that address various ailments.
- Tai chi, a gentle form of Exercise, cultivates inner peace and enhances overall well-being.
By embracing the principles of Traditional Chinese Healing, individuals can Achieve a deeper understanding of their bodies and embark on a path to holistic health and Well-being.
